Transaction 32cbd4877945597ba6d015c98b190b48722487c851e7750428583e4b304aeb39

1 Input
2 Outputs
  • 32cbd4877945597ba6d015c98b190b48722487c851e7750428583e4b304aeb39:0
  • value  1260742
    address  388fHbhURERTA3SkeBGtMNxgTwgmWCi3FK
  • 32cbd4877945597ba6d015c98b190b48722487c851e7750428583e4b304aeb39:1
  • value  4242298
    address  3Fi775F4WjZVTqZ1BjAEDvJdxH9ZKyyeZs